离子选择电极法与离子色谱法测定生活饮用水中氟化物的比较

摘    要:为比较离子选择电极法和离子色谱法测定水中氟化物是否存在显著性差异,分别使用两种方法测定了永州市两个集中式生活饮用水水源地的地表水中含氟量。并采用SPSS13.0软件对两种方法测定结果进行了统计检验。其检验结果显示,两种方法的精密度、准确度和测定结果无显著性差异,均可作为测定生活饮用水中氟含量的方法。

Comparison on Determination of Fluorine Compound in Drinking Water by Ion Selective Electrode Method and Ion Chromatography

Abstract:To compare the fluoride ion selecting electrode(FISE) method with ion chromatography(IC) method for determination of F-,we collected 4 surface-water samples from 2 areas in drinking water of Yongzhou and detected he fluoride content.The results as matched data were tested by SPSS13.0.The results indicated that there were not distinctive differences in the precision,accuracy and determination results of FISE and IC.So fluoride content in drinking water could be determined by the two method of FISE and IC.
